Java与Kotlin互相调用KotlinTesxtMe.kt文件:object KotlinTesxtMe { val sum = {x: Int, y: Int -> x + y}// la
原创
2022-08-04 10:27:20
58阅读
# Kotlin和Java互调用的实现方法
## 1. 流程概述
在Kotlin和Java互调用的过程中,主要分为以下几个步骤:
| 步骤 | 描述 |
| --- | --- |
| 步骤1 | 在Kotlin中编写Java调用的类 |
| 步骤2 | 在Kotlin中调用Java类 |
| 步骤3 | 在Java中调用Kotlin类 |
接下来,我将详细介绍每一步的具体实现方法。
#
原创
2023-12-27 09:29:03
74阅读
首先从界面上看,之前的XML文件底部是可以来回切换查看界面设计和xml代码以及预览,现在可以同时展示出来,还算是一个比较实用的优化 注意看图的右上角哦,底部没有切换按钮了(很多兄dei第一次更新之后都不知道怎么查看xml代码了, 注意细节!注意细节啊!同学!) 然后在 Android Studio 3.6 中,颜色选取器将填充应用中的颜色资源
转载
2024-06-06 07:22:31
36阅读
# Kotlin和Java如何互调
Kotlin作为一种现代编程语言,与Java有着良好的兼容性。这使得很多现有的Java项目可以无缝迁移到Kotlin,而不必完全重写代码。在本文中,我们将深入探讨Kotlin与Java互调的方式,并提供一些具体的代码示例。同时,我们还将运用Mermaid语法来展示饼状图和甘特图,以便更好地呈现一些概念。
## Kotlin与Java的互操作性概述
Kotl
1. Java 与 Kotlin 交互的语法变
原创
2022-09-13 16:55:55
112阅读
1.在kotlin中调用Java方法Kotlin和Java是两种不同的语言,所以在互相调用的时
转载
2023-01-05 11:52:17
351阅读
SpringBoot之从Java到Kotlin(混用)-1介绍第一篇博客环境及版本开始工程结构修改代码转换大概步骤转换中遇到的问题小结 介绍第一篇博客一直不知道记些什么,恰好最近看了下Kotlin,打算实际使用一番,就拿前一段自己基于SpringCloud搭建了一套后台程序试手吧,记录由Java改为Kotlin过程中遇到的坑和Kotlin的优缺点。环境及版本Eclipse OxygenJDK 8
转载
2023-10-18 18:23:45
57阅读
数天前我将我java开发的工程,全部转换成了kotlin形式的工程。如果你也想做,本身也有一定的java开发安卓程序的功底。本文将比较适
原创
2023-06-19 10:15:52
98阅读
Coroutine协程是kotlin实现的一种异步执行逻辑的方式,相对与传统的线程,协程更加简洁,高效,占用资源少。那协程到底是怎么实现异步的呢?线程在现在的操作系统中,线程是CPU调度的最少单元。所有的程序逻辑运行在线程之上。在Java API中, Thread是实现线程的基本类。它的内部实现是大量的 JNI 调用,因为线程的实现必须由操作系统直接提供支持。在 Android 平台上,Threa
项目基于idea 生成,主要是说明使用方法 环境准备 项目结构 main.kt fun main(args: Array<String>) { val user: User = User(); user.age=333; user.name="dalong" println("this is my
原创
2021-07-18 16:40:43
292阅读
kotlin与java部分基础类比1.变量声明: 有var和val两个关键字来声明,其中val是只读关键字相当于java的final 声明的写法比如 var name: String = “asan” 和 var name = "asan"的作用是一样的,既声明了一个值为“asan”的字符串name。 如果声明的时候不能明确变量的值,需要这么写:lateinit var name: String,
!image20201015161230476(https://s4.51cto.com/images/blog/202202/17085140_620d9c1c7623757495.jpg?xossprocess=image/watermark,size_14,text_QDUxQ1RP5Y2a5a6i,color_FFFFFF,t_100,g_se,x_10,y_10,shadow_20,ty
原创
精选
2022-02-17 08:53:55
774阅读
# Python与Java互调:一种跨语言的协作方式
在现代软件开发中,使用多种编程语言来构建复杂系统是很常见的现象。Python因其简单易用、适合快速开发而备受欢迎,而Java则以其强大的性能和跨平台特性在企业级应用中占据重要地位。本篇文章将探讨如何实现Python与Java的互调,并通过代码示例进行说明。
## 互调的背景
*“互调”一词,意指不同语言之间的相互调用。* 在某些情况下,我
## Node.js与Java互调实现流程
为了实现Node.js和Java之间的互调,需要使用到Node.js的`child_process`模块来执行Java程序,并通过子进程间的标准输入输出来进行通信。
整个流程可以分为以下几个步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 启动Node.js服务 |
| 2 | 创建子进程 |
| 3 | 子进程执行Java程
原创
2023-08-09 08:11:01
599阅读
# Java方法互调
在Java中,我们经常需要在不同的方法中进行互相调用来完成某个功能。这种方法互调的机制使得代码更加模块化和可复用,提高了代码的可读性和可维护性。本文将介绍Java方法互调的基本原理和示例代码。
## 基本原理
在Java中,方法之间的调用是通过方法名实现的。当一个方法需要调用另一个方法时,只需要使用另一个方法的方法名即可。在调用方法时,需要注意方法的可见性和参数的传递。
原创
2024-05-04 07:06:39
27阅读
# 从uniapp调用Java的实现方法
在开发过程中,我们常常会遇到前端和后端需要相互调用的情况。对于uniapp应用来说,它是一款跨平台的应用开发框架,可以同时为多个平台(如iOS、Android等)提供应用。那么在uniapp中,如何实现与Java后端的互相调用呢?
## uniapp与Java的互相调用方法
在uniapp中,我们可以通过`uni.request`方法来实现调用Jav
原创
2024-04-01 05:34:39
203阅读
嘿,我想我会回答这件事,尽管已经很晚了。我认为,首先要考虑的是Java和python之间的链接有多强。第一您只想调用函数还是实际上希望python代码更改java对象中的数据?这是非常重要的。如果您只想调用一些带参数或不带参数的python代码,那么这并不困难。如果您的参数是原语,那么它将使它更加容易。但是,如果您想让java类在python中实现成员函数(这会改变java对象的数据),那么这就不
转载
2023-10-01 09:31:59
55阅读
# Java Service 互调的基本概念与实践
在现代软件开发中,微服务架构越来越受到青睐。微服务架构允许将一个大型应用程序分解为多个小服务,每个服务可以独立地开发、部署和扩展。在这样的架构中,不同的微服务可能需要互相调用,这就是我们今天要讨论的“Java Service 互调”。
## 什么是 Service 互调?
“Service 互调”是指不同服务之间相互调用的过程。在 Java
原创
2024-10-11 09:59:16
25阅读
nodejs 与java的互调用方法很多,我们可选的是使用oracle 新的vm 引擎(graalvm很不错) 还有就是基于browserify进行包装,同时给java 提供一套require 的模式机制,但是对于原 生的nodejs 来说就有一些问题了,社区有人提供了一个基于jni的node 包装
原创
2021-07-18 16:45:38
3294阅读
# 如何实现Java构造方法互调
## 1. 整体流程
下面是实现Java构造方法互调的流程:
```mermaid
sequenceDiagram
participant A as 刚入行的小白
participant B as 经验丰富的开发者
A->>B: 请求教学如何实现构造方法互调
B->>A: 解释整体流程
B->>A: 提供每一步的代码
原创
2024-03-29 07:36:05
20阅读